What are the height and setback rules for a fence on my property in Port Edwards?
Port Edwards zoning enforces a 3-foot height limit in front yards and a 6-foot limit in rear yards. The setback is 0 feet, meaning you can build on the property line. For corner lots near WI-54, you must maintain a clear 'sight triangle' for traffic visibility; any fence in this zone must not exceed 3 feet in height.
How do modern gate systems integrate with pool safety and liability standards in Wisconsin?
The International Swimming Pool and Spa Code (ISPSC) requires self-closing, self-latching gates with specific latch heights. While smart-gate IoT integration is a low trend here in 2026, any automated system must fail-safe to meet these codes. An integrated, code-compliant latch system is critical for limiting homeowner liability.
What is my legal obligation to a neighbor when replacing a shared fence in Port Edwards?
Wisconsin Statute 90.03, the 'good neighbor law,' mandates written notification to adjoining owners before replacing a shared boundary fence. As of 2026, this must be completed at least 15 days prior to work. This statute establishes the legal framework for cost-sharing and prevents disputes.
Why is a 48-inch footing depth a structural requirement for fences in Port Edwards Central?
The 48-inch frost line depth in this zone is a non-negotiable IRC standard. Posts set shallower will lift from frost heave, causing permanent racking and failure. In Port Edwards Central, this deep footing anchors the structure against seasonal ground movement, ensuring long-term stability.
How do local soil and pest conditions influence fence material selection in Port Edwards?
With low to moderate soil corrosivity and a slight to moderate termite risk, material compatibility is key. Pressure-treated pine for posts requires hot-dip galvanized or stainless-ste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Non-cellulosic materials like vinyl or composite offer high resistance to both corrosion and insect damage in this environment.

What is the required process for utility location before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Diggers Hotline (811) at least three business days before excavation. They mark all public utility lines. In Port Edwards Central, hitting a buried line is a major financial and safety liability. How does the 105 MPH V-ult wind speed rating affect fence design here?
The 105 MPH ultimate design wind speed, per ASCE 7-22 standards, dictates structural capacity. This rating requires specific post spacing, concrete footing mass, and bracket strength to survive peak storm season gusts, which are influenced by open exposure from Alexander Field Airport. Standard residential fences often fail to meet this engineering requirement.
